ORANGE BEACH, Ala. (AP) — A coastal mayor says tests show tar balls washed onto Alabama’s beaches by a recent tropical storm are from last year’s BP oil spill in the Gulf of Mexico.
Orange Beach Mayor Tony Kennon said Tuesday the connection was found in preliminary tests performed by Auburn University. Kennon says additional tests will be conducted.
Tropical Storm Lee dumped tar balls on the coast. BP says additional cleanup workers were added at the request of area leaders, and teams also are working longer hours.
